In electronic components, the term Accuracy usually refers to the accuracy of a value measured by a sensor or measuring device.
In electronic components, accuracy plays a very important role in the performance and reliability of a component or system.
For example, if a sensor is not accurate, the system can make decisions based on incorrect information, which can have dangerous or costly consequences.
Therefore, when designing or selecting electronic components, accuracy is one of the most important considerations.
In addition, since the required level of accuracy differs depending on the environment in which electronic components are used, when selecting components, it is necessary to select a component that meets the required accuracy in the environment.
